Reminder to all students: Please remember that our dress code expectations apply to all students. You must follow the rules. IF you show up to school with clothes that are not compliant with our dress code rules, we will assume you are intentionally not following them, and you will be assigned to ISS for the day.
According to the handbook, all students are to be off school grounds unless under supervision of a teacher or coach. That means, no hanging around in the commons or other areas, including outside on the school grounds. If you are done with a teacher at 3:15, please come to the office and call for a ride home. The 4:00 bus is intended for those who are staying for ESD/EADs, tutoring, etc. and are here until 3:45 or 4:00. If you are done with one teacher at 3:15, it is okay to find another one who can supervise you reading or working, but you must be sitting in a classroom if you are sticking around.
School IDs must be worn at all times. Students without IDS in the classroom or the halls, will be assigned an ESD if they are in pockets, folders, or just not on you. The price for IDs is $2.50. That will get you the ID and the sleeve. If you need a lanyard the cost will be $3.50.
*It is required that students charge your Chromebooks at home each night. Each student and parent signed the agreement before you were loaned a Chromebook. We will no longer be loaning out chargers during the school day. If you forget to charge it, you may plug it in at lunch in the commons area. Until then, you will need to use paper and pencil in your class.
